Strong's H8506 in the Old Testament

2 indexed usages in Old Testament.

Exodus 5:18 KJV

Go therefore now, and work; for there shall no straw be given you, yet shall ye deliver the tale of bricks.

Ezekiel 45:11 KJV

The ephah and the bath shall be of one measure, that the bath may contain the tenth part of an homer, and the ephah the tenth part of an homer: the measure thereof shall be after the homer.
